It accepts `seriesNames` as either a string, list, or dictionary. A string renames a specific series by `seriesIndex`. A list sets series names based on their index. A dictionary maps existing series names to new ones. The function returns a new chart (`ui.Chart`) with the updated series names, leaving the original chart untouched. The `seriesIndex` argument is used only when a single string is passed to `seriesNames`.\n"]]
